Description

This fully furnished and professionally redesigned waterfront residence blends timeless character with modern luxury in one of North Kingstown's most sought-after neighborhoods. Set on a quiet cul-de-sac in the historic Loop Drive community, the home enjoys a naturalized yard along Cedar Cove with sweeping 180 water views and unforgettable sunsets. Just a short walk to Wickford Village, it offers the perfect balance of privacy, convenience, and coastal charm.

Completely restored and thoughtfully updated, the 3-bedroom, 1.5-bath home showcases high ceilings, abundant natural light, and refinished hardwood floors, complemented by designer lighting and elegant finishes. The gourmet kitchen features top-tier appliances, a pot filler, and custom details that make it as functional as it is refined. A triple glass slider opens to a spacious deck overlooking the water perfect for entertaining or unwinding.

Every detail has been considered, including two laundry centers (a dual washer/dryer on the bedroom level and full-size units in the basement), a new heating system, and an on-demand tankless water heater. Ample storage includes a full basement and attic, while a detached barn adds flexibility.

With its coastal views, high-end finishes, and walkable location, this home offers a rare opportunity to lease a residence that feels new while honoring its Wickford charm. Close to Wickford Village, Jamestown, Newport, East Greenwich, and T.F. Green Airport with easy access to Boston. Tenant pays electricity, propane and pet deposit if animal is accepted.
